Output 2fadfaf3aa1f5b1850b60bda15c177671c84f6109bdff8e9cd1df8d1c3ee6f86:0

value
1328962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f5417a1500d292bdf6117a0a0b76ccb06956b91 OP_EQUAL
address
3DJGUjzPM64Z6CoVKpTw525Hf6YGqStUfa
transaction
2fadfaf3aa1f5b1850b60bda15c177671c84f6109bdff8e9cd1df8d1c3ee6f86
spent
true